Árvore de páginas

Versões comparadas

Chave

  • Esta linha foi adicionada.
  • Esta linha foi removida.
  • A formatação mudou.


01. DADOS GERAIS

Produto:

TOTVS Backoffice

Solucoes_totvs
Solucao

Solucoes_totvs_cross
SolucaoCross

Solucoes_totvs_parceiros
SolucaoParceiros

Solucoes_totvs_parceirosexptotvs
SolucaoParcsExpsTOTVS

Linha de Produto:

Linha Protheus 

Linhas_totvs

Segmento:

Backoffice SP 

Segmentos_totvs
Segmento

Módulo:ATIVO FIXO (SIGAATF)
Função:CADASTRO DE ATIVO (ATFA012)
Ticket:20478973
Requisito/Story/Issue (informe o requisito relacionado) :DSERCTR1-45722

...

Foi disponibilizada uma correção da rotina ATFA012 (20189477 DSERCTR1-45880 DT Inclusão do tipo 10 com depreciaçao acumulada não gera N4_OCORR igual a 20), quando no momento da inclusão do tipo 10 com depreciação acumulada, o sistema não gerou o registro na tabela SN4 com o campo N4_OCORR = 20, nos bens que haviam sofrido transferências de filiais.
Esta correção irá atender apenas novos registros, ou seja, o legado continua sem a informação na tabela SN4. 

03. SOLUÇÃO

Disponibilizado um FIX para corrigir os bens de legado.

04. FUNCIONALIDADE


Aviso
titleImportante

Testar a funcionalidade em ambiente de Homologação


Com o patch do FIX aplicado na base, adicione o programa SN4AJOCORR20 no Menu de preferência:

Image Modified

Classificação de Compras (ATFA240)

Ao realizar a Classificação de Compras (ATFA240) de um bem que possui um CIAP vinculado, ao digitar a taxa anual de depreciação 1 do bem de tipo 01 - Fiscal ou 03 - Adiantamento.

O campo N3_PERDEPR receberá o valor de vida útil do bem conforme o parâmetro MV_CALCDEP - Determina a forma de calculo da depreciação, sendo:  0 = Mensal ou 1 = Anual.

 0 - Mensal  = taxa anual de depreciação 1 * 12

1 - Anual = 100 / taxa anual de depreciação 1

...

Transferência de Ativos (ATFA060)

Ao realizar a transferência contábil alterando a taxa de depreciação de um bem que possui um CIAP vinculado, o valor da vida útil será atualizado (F9_VIDUTIL).

Ao realizar uma transferência física gerando uma Nota Fiscal de Entrada com CIAP, o bem criado na filial destino terá o campo N3_PERDEPR preenchido com a vida útil conforme o parâmetro MV_CALCDEP.

O CIAP gerado na filial destino receberá o conteúdo:

F9_VIDUTIL = N3_PERDEPR
F9_FUNCIT = N1_DESCRIC 

Aquisição por Transferência (ATFA251)

Ao realizar uma aquisição por transferência ao qual será incluso um novo registro de CIAP,  o bem adquirido terá o campo N3_PERDEPR preenchido com a vida útil conforme o parâmetro MV_CALCDEP.

O CIAP gerado receberá o conteúdo:

F9_VIDUTIL = N3_PERDEPR
F9_FUNCIT = N3_HISTOR

Ampliação do bem (ATFA155)

Ao realizar uma ampliação de um bem que possui um CIAP vinculado,  valor da vida útil será atualizado (F9_VIDUTIL).

Alteração da Taxa de Depreciação Automática (ATFA230)

Ao realizar a atualização de taxa de depreciação de um bem que possui um CIAP vinculado,  valor da vida útil será atualizado (F9_VIDUTIL).

Manutenção do Cadastro de Taxas Regulamentadas (ATFA290)

...


Ao acessar o Protheus e abrir o programa adicionado no Menu, selecione o diretório e o nome de arquivo para gravação do Log.

E clique em Salvar.

Image Added


Obs: Caso esteja utilizando o SmartClient Web clique em Não na mensagem abaixo:

Image Added



Aviso
titleImportante

Como medida de segurança e performance, o programa por Default irá apenas buscar os registros onde o N3_DINDEPR "Data Inicio Depreciação" é igual ou maior a data de 01/01/2023.

Caso surja a necessidade de alterar essa data, pode-se criar o parâmetro MV_FIXATF0 localmente e definir o seu conteúdo.

Lembrando que a lógica é maior ou igual, a data preenchida nesse parâmetro será a data de partida para as buscas dos Ativos.

NOMETIPODESCRIÇÃOCONTEÚDO PADRÃO
MV_FIXATF0CARACTERDefine a data de partida a ser considerada no FIX20230101


O programa terá as opções: 

Bens sem Depreciação

Bens com Depreciação

Imp. Bens com Deprec.

Imp. Bens sem Deprec.


Image Added


Imp. Bens sem Deprec.

Irá gravar no arquivo de Log os registros encontrados para a opção Bens sem Depreciação.

A utilização dessa opção é ideal para conferência dos registros que serão considerados quando a opção Bens sem Depreciação for selecionada.

Recomendamos a utilização da mesma para pré-conferência antes de executar a operação Bens sem Depreciação.


Imp. Bens com Deprec.

Irá gravar no arquivo de Log os registros encontrados para a opção Bens com Depreciação.

A utilização dessa opção é ideal para conferência dos registros que serão considerados quando a opção Bens com Depreciação for selecionada.

Recomendamos a utilização da mesma para pré-conferência antes de executar a operação Bens com Depreciação.

Bens com Depreciação:

Ao selecionar essa opção, o programa irá perguntar a filial que deseja incluir a movimentação, ou seja, a filial que não teve o movimento de depreciação acumulada quando o tipo 10 - Gerencial foi incluído no bem. 


Image Added


Ao digitar a filial e confirmar a operação, será realizada uma consulta analisando a depreciação dos bens da empresa e identificando quais deles têm discrepâncias no valor de depreciação acumulada, sendo eles bens que foram originados de uma transferência entre filiais, são do tipo 10 - Gerencial e a inclusão do tipo 10 foi feita através da rotina ATFA012.

Aqui está uma explicação simples do que a consulta está fazendo e do resultado final que ela procura:

    1. Filtragem por Filial: A consulta está focando apenas na filial digitada conforme a imagem anterior.
    2. Comparação de Valores: Está comparando o valor acumulado de depreciação registrado (N3_VRDACM1) com a soma dos valores de depreciação (N4_VLROC1) do bem, sendo eles no tipo 10 - Gerencial, Ocorrência igual a 20 (N4_OCORR) e Conta de Depreciação Acumulada igual a 4 (N4_TIPOCNT).
    3. Cálculo da Diferença: Calcula a diferença entre esses valores de depreciação. N3_VRDACM1 -  soma dos valores de depreciação (N4_VLROC1).

O valor dessa diferença será o valor do movimento a ser criado.

Os demais campos da SN4 serão com base no movimento de Ocorrência 05. Sendo eles:

N4_FILIAL,N4_CBASE,N4_ITEM,N4_TIPO,N4_CONTA,N4_DATA,N4_TXDEPR,N4_CCUSTO,N4_SEQ,N4_SUBCTA, ;
N4_SEQREAV, N4_CLVL, N4_IDMOV, N4_TPSALDO, N4_CALCPIS, N4_LA,N4_ORIGEM, N4_LP, N4_HORA


Exemplo:

Image Added

A imagem acima mostra um bem que possui depreciação acumulada na SN3 divergente da ou das Depreciação(es) acumulada(s) encontrada(s) na tabela SN4.

Valor diferença: 100

Valor do movimento a ser incluído: 100

Após a execução do FIX:

Image Added

Movimento incluído.

Bens sem Depreciação:

Ao selecionar essa opção, o programa irá perguntar a filial que deseja incluir a movimentação, ou seja, a filial que não teve o movimento de depreciação acumulada quando o tipo 10 - Gerencial foi incluído no bem. 


Image Added


Ao digitar a filial e confirmar a operação, será realizada uma consulta procurando os bens que, de acordo com os registros (N3_VRDACM1 maior que 0 ) deveriam estar sofrendo depreciação, mas não têm nenhuma depreciação registrada N4_OCORR igual a 20 e N4_TIPOCNT igual a 4.

Aqui está uma explicação simples do que a consulta está fazendo e do resultado final que ela procura:

  1. Foco em uma Filial Específica: A consulta está focando apenas na filial digitada conforme a imagem anterior.
  2. Identificação de Bens sem Depreciação: Ela verifica quais bens deveriam ter depreciação registrada (com base nas condições abaixo) mas não têm.

        Condições:

Está procurando registros que são do tipo 10 - Gerencial "e esse tipo foi incluído através da rotina ATFA012 " onde possuem ocorrência 05 "Inclusão", que estão sem Registro de Ocorrência 20 "Depreciação Acumulada" e possuem o valor Acumulado de Depreciação Positivo com base no campo N3_VRDACM1.


O valor encontrado no campo N3_VRDACM1 será o valor do movimento a ser criado.

Os demais campos da SN4 serão com base no movimento de Ocorrência 05. Sendo eles:

N4_FILIAL,N4_CBASE,N4_ITEM,N4_TIPO,N4_CONTA,N4_DATA,N4_TXDEPR,N4_CCUSTO,N4_SEQ,N4_SUBCTA, ;
N4_SEQREAV, N4_CLVL, N4_IDMOV, N4_TPSALDO, N4_CALCPIS, N4_LA,N4_ORIGEM, N4_LP, N4_HORA


Exemplo:

Image Added

A imagem acima mostra um bem que possui depreciação acumulada na SN3 porem não existe o movimento de Depreciação acumulada na tabela SN4.

Valor do movimento a ser incluído: 1500

Após a execução do FIX:

Image Added

Movimento incluído

...

.

05. ASSUNTOS RELACIONADOS

...